Benefits of DISAB DISA-RAIL 1700
● Flexible Transport: The unit is easily mounted onto the Eco Rail MPC30 chassis using quick couplers, enabling highly flexible transport on both public roads and railway tracks.
● Streamlined Operation: When teamed with an excavator, the DISA-RAIL 1700 creates a flexible machine system with high capacity and precision. Operators can smoothly control all functions, including precise nozzle positioning and hydraulic side tipping to drain material, using an in-cab radio control without ever leaving their seat.
● Continuous Material Handling: The machine can suck up large amounts of both dry and wet masses in the same process without needing to stop and empty the container in between. It handles a wide range of coarse and fine materials (such as macadam, soil, clay, water, and leaves) and features fully automatic filter cleaning during operation, which helps prevent unnecessary stops.
● Versatile Applications: It efficiently tackles challenging railway maintenance tasks, such as loading hard-to-reach macadam, clearing cable ductings, soaking up wet masses from wells, and sucking away harmful dust while working in tunnels.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Which functions are controlled via the radio transmitter?
Via the in-cab radio transmitter, operators can smoothly control several key functions without leaving their seat. These include starting/stopping the engine, turning the vacuum on/off, adjusting speeds (min, average, max), activating hydraulic side tipping, opening/closing discharge hatches, and triggering a pneumatic vibrator for smooth discharge.
How are the filters cleaned?
The automatic filter cleaning is a pneumatic system that functions fully automatically while running. The machine separates the bulk material into the main chamber and passes fine dust into a separate filter chamber. The system continuously drops trapped dust to the bottom of the chamber, preventing clogs, avoiding downtime, and ensuring a dust-free environment.
What are the benefits of the side tipping feature?
It provides an efficient way to dispose of collected materials like soil, clay, water, or macadam. Activated remotely via radio control, the operator can safely drain the tank from the excavator cab, and it can be paired with a pneumatic vibrator to ensure a completely smooth discharge.
Can the unit be customized with different hose sizes?
Yes.
While it comes with a standard 200 mm suction hose, it can be customized. Options include manifolds with smaller vacuum connections for tight spaces (or hand-held nozzles), longer hoses utilizing the machine’s powerful suction, and specific attachments like extension tubes or rubber-edged tubes.
Dust-free work environment
With DISA-RAIL 1700 you handle dusting materials with ease. You can also suck up dust pollution in the air, during work in tunnels. Even coarse material such as macadam contains large amounts of particles and dust. These can pose health risks and unnecessary stops, if spread to the environment.
With DISAB’s proven air filtering technology, you soak up fine-grained and dusty materials very effectively. The filter cleaning is fully automatic during operation, as material falls to the bottom of the filter chamber.
